India Pulls Out of Asia Cup: Tensions Flare!
India has withdrawn from the Asia Cup 2025 and Women's Emerging Teams Asia Cup due to Pakistan's leadership of the Asian Cricket Council. The Board of Control for Cricket in India cited conflict of interest and national sentiment as reasons behind the exit. This move may destabilize the tournament and impact its commercial viability, with a cancellation or delay likely unless a compromise is reached.

Quick Commerce Grows, Still Small for FMCG Giants
Quick commerce in India sees growth for FMCG companies, with sales up 50-100% in FY25. Despite this surge, it accounts for 2-4% of sales for major players like HUL and Britannia. Companies like HUL and AWL Agri Business report better margins in quick commerce due to premium product sales. This growth impacts traditional retail, with quick commerce gaining share in top cities. Cumulative quick commerce sales exceed ₹4,400 crore for six major firms.
Trump's memecoin dinner: Politics and profit mix?
Donald Trump is hosting a dinner for the top 220 investors in his $TRUMP memecoin at his Virginia golf club. The top 25 get special access, including a White House tour. Critics say this blurs the lines between politics and profit, potentially allowing foreign influence. The crypto industry, despite some concerns, largely supports Trump's return due to his favorable stance on digital currencies. This event complicates crypto legislation efforts.

India's Telecom Policy Aims for More Jobs, Exports
India's new telecom policy aims to double exports, create one million jobs by 2030. The National Telecom Policy targets universal connectivity at affordable rates through terrestrial and satellite networks. It also aims to increase the ICT sector's contribution to India's GDP from 7.8% to 11%. Annual investment of ₹1.5 lakh crore in telecom infrastructure is expected.
